Do you need a international driving permit for the USA?

Options
Anyone know? I've got a permanent new style license but not sure whether I need to apply for an international driving permit for hiring a car in the USA? Don't really want to be left with no car but I don't see why it would be needed.

    You don't need one to DRIVE a car in the USA.

    It's possible that some car hire outfits might ask to see one to HIRE a car. I've never come across this, but have seen the very occasional assertion that it is so, so it would be wise to check it out.

    International Driving Permits are only really useful if your original licence is not in English. British Driving licences are absolutely fine as long as you take both the photocard and paper part (i've even got away with just the photocard but I wouldn't take the chance). Don't worry about it.

    Just remember in California, you cannot have anything stuck to the windscreen, so if you are taking a satnav or phone holder it cannot be on the windscreen, (You will get a ticket if the cops see it).

    Other than that have a great time, don't be freaked out by the traffic most drivers are very friendly and will back off to let you move over if you make a mistake in lanes etc.
